First of all we weeded a patch totally taken over by mint, leaving just one corner; I am going to plant 5 more hardy herbs there - probably parsley, which seems to survive a year or two, chives, thyme, rosemary, sage if my seedling survive and one other - not sure if basil would take it or not? i will sink slates around the mint and weed it ferociously and divide them all up with cobbles to look pretty. Today we stripped the leaves off all the mint as a family project, then washed it, chopped it and freezed it - we did two other batches, one as frozen leaves and one drying in the boiler room as a project to see what works best! Can't believe how much everything has grown so had to have a major day at the seed boxes. here's what we did.... * Earthed up the potatoes - enormous 6 inches in a week i would say. * Pulled the second lot of radishes and resowed that box - carrots and spring onions coming on nicely in first sowing now. * Planted a second set of squashes... sigh.... * Planted all the herbs in the first batch into big tubs and put one lot of each into the girls painted ones. * Planted the leeks into deep boxes in rows of three- need to get organised to do their blackout with something. * Tied the peas up to their canes. * Planted the two recovered lavenders into bigger pots where i hope they will do better. * Discarded the garlic which had died a death - dodgy bulbs and over zealous watering by Moo i think!
